A Project Manager in the ecommerce sector is the central architect who turns digital strategy into operational reality. This role sits at the critical intersection of business, technology, and user experience, driving initiatives that directly impact online revenue, customer satisfaction, and market competitiveness. Professionals in these jobs are responsible for planning, executing, and finalizing projects within scope, budget, and time constraints, ensuring that every launch or enhancement aligns with overarching business goals. Typically, an Ecommerce Project Manager oversees the entire lifecycle of digital projects. This includes website redesigns, platform migrations (like moving to Shopify or Adobe Commerce), integration of new payment gateways or CRM systems, and the implementation of sophisticated features such as personalized shopping or advanced analytics dashboards. Common responsibilities involve defining project scope and objectives, managing resources across multidisciplinary teams—including developers, designers, marketers, and merchandisers—and mitigating risks that could derail timelines or functionality. They act as the primary communicator, translating technical details for business stakeholders and conveying business needs to technical teams, ensuring seamless collaboration. To excel in these jobs, individuals need a robust blend of technical understanding and leadership skills. A firm grasp of ecommerce platforms, digital marketing fundamentals, web technologies, and agile methodologies is essential. Typical requirements often include proven experience in project management, often certified by methodologies like PMP, Scrum, or PRINCE2. Key skills extend beyond tools like Jira, Asana, or Microsoft Project; they include exceptional stakeholder management, budget forecasting, problem-solving under pressure, and a keen eye for optimizing the online customer journey. The best candidates are adaptable, data-driven, and possess a commercial mindset focused on conversion rates and ROI. Ultimately, project manager jobs in ecommerce are ideal for those who thrive in fast-paced environments where consumer behavior and technology constantly evolve. It is a career built on delivering tangible digital products that drive growth, enhance user experience, and solidify a brand's online presence.
